In the BN14 area, we frequently encounter washing machine faults related to hard water deposits affecting heating elements and pumps, common in this part of West Sussex. We also see increased wear on door seals and bearings in machines housed in the traditional outbuildings and utility spaces typical of Ashington's older properties.
For Ashington homeowners, we recommend considering repair for washing machines under 8 years old, as quality repairs often provide several more years of reliable service at a fraction of replacement cost. Given the village's mix of period and modern properties, we also consider installation constraints and energy efficiency improvements when advising on repair versus replacement decisions.
